How they compare
Qatar currently reports 3,282 units per square kilometre against 57.44 units per square kilometre in North America, a difference of 3,225 units per square kilometre.
That makes Qatar's figure about 57.1 times North America's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 50 shared years of data; in 1974 it was North America ahead.
North America ranks 8th and Qatar ranks 7th of 44 groups.
Qatar has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| North America | Qatar |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 14.43 units per square kilometre | 23.99 units per square kilometre | 9.57 units per square kilometre | Qatar |
| 1980s | 21.32 units per square kilometre | 54.98 units per square kilometre | 33.65 units per square kilometre | Qatar |
| 1990s | 30.3 units per square kilometre | 101.88 units per square kilometre | 71.57 units per square kilometre | Qatar |
| 2000s | 39.49 units per square kilometre | 504.42 units per square kilometre | 464.93 units per square kilometre | Qatar |
| 2010s | 48.42 units per square kilometre | 2,021 units per square kilometre | 1,973 units per square kilometre | Qatar |
| 2020s | 42.29 units per square kilometre | 2,016 units per square kilometre | 1,974 units per square kilometre | Qatar |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Air transport, passengers carried div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
